Ingredients
For the Crispy Roasted Cauliflower
- 1 head Cauliflower, cut into florets
- 3 tablespoons Olive oil
- 1/2 cup Panko bre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up Grated Parmesan cheese (optional) (Can be omitted for a vegan version.)
- 1 teaspoon Sm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on Garlic powder
- to taste Salt and black pepper
How to Make Crispy Roasted Cauliflower
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C) and line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it.
Step 2: Prepare the Cauliflower
Wash and thoroughly dry the cauliflower. Cut it into medium-sized florets to ensure even cooking.
Step 3: Coat with Olive Oil
In a large bowl, toss the florets with olive oil until they are evenly coated.
Step 4: Season It Up
Sprinkle the smoked paprika,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per over the cauliflower. Mix until all pieces are well coated.
Step 5: Add Crunch Factor
Toss in the panko breadcrumbs and Parmesan cheese (if using). Stir well to ensure each floret is coated with crumbs.
Step 6: Roast in Oven
Spread the coated cauliflower in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et. Leave space between florets for even roasting. Place it in the preheated oven.
Step 7: Flip Halfway Through Cooking
Roast for 20-25 minutes, flipping once halfway through. Look for golden-brown color to indicate they’re crispy.
Step 8: Serve Hot
Remove from oven and let cool slightly before serving. Enjoy hot as a snack, side dish, or part of a larger spread!

How to Perfect Crispy Roasted Cauliflower
Achieving the perfect Crispy Roasted Cauliflower requires attention to detail. Here are some tips to ensure your dish turns out perfectly every time.
- 
Choose the right cauliflower: Look for fresh, firm heads of cauliflower without dark spots for the best flavor. 
- 
Cut evenly: Ensure all florets are similar in size to promote even cooking and crispiness. 
- 
Dry thoroughly: Patting the cauliflower dry after washing helps the oil and seasonings stick better, enhancing the crispiness. 
- 
Use enough oil: A generous coating of olive oil is crucial for achieving that golden, crispy texture. 
- 
Don’t overcrowd the pan: Spacing out the florets on the baking sheet allows hot air to circulate, ensuring they roast rather than steam.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
To achieve the perfect Crispy Roasted Cauliflower, it’s essential to avoid some common pitfalls.
- Boldly skipping drying – Not drying the cauliflower can lead to soggy florets. Make sure to wash and thoroughly dry them before oiling.
- Boldly overcrowding the pan – Crowding your baking sheet will steam the cauliflower instead of roasting it. Space out the florets for optimal crispiness.
- Boldly neglecting seasoning – For flavorful cauliflower, don’t skimp on spices. Ensure you season well with salt, pepper, and paprika for a tasty finish.
- Boldly changing oven temperature – Baking at too low a temperature will result in soft cauliflower. Stick to 425°F (220°C) for crispy results.
- Boldly forgetting to flip – Flipping halfway through cooking is crucial for even browning. Turn the florets to ensure all sides get golden and crunchy.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Allow the cauliflower to cool completely before sealing to prevent condensation.
Freezing Crispy Roasted Cauliflower
- Freeze in a single layer on a baking sheet before transferring to an airtight container.
- Best consumed within 2-3 months for optimal taste and texture.
Reheating Crispy Roasted Cauliflower
- Oven – Preheat to 375°F (190°C), spread on a baking sheet, and heat for about 10-15 minutes until crispy.
- Microwave – Heat on medium power for 1-2 minutes. Note: this may soften the cauliflower slightly.
- Stovetop – Sauté in a non-stick skillet over medium heat for about 5 minutes, turning frequently until heated through.
